I'm working on Alien Biomes now.

You may already know that terrain generation changed in 0.17: https://www.factorio.com/blog/post/fff-282
It's more complicated now, using sand-1 tile type as an example, the vanilla autoplace setting has gone from around 25 lines in 0.16 to around 500 lines in 0.17

Vanilla factorio uses mostly 2d biome placement, Alien biomes uses mostly 3d placement so I can't use the same utility functions as the vanilla tile types, I need to reverse engineer the existing ones to make my own and then fit them into an already complicated biome distribution system.

The new 0.17 compatible version is released on the mod portal. It's taken over 100 hours of work to get this far.


I kept people updated with the development on discord, here are some of the highlights:


Initially almost nothing worked, trees and decoratives were all over the place. There were wetland trees in the desert, desert trees in the snow, and squiggly blue things everywhere. I poured many hours into trying to sort out the settings, but it gradually become clear. The settings were right but there was a bug in factorio:
